About Åke E. Andersson
Åke E. Andersson is a scholar working on Economics and Econometrics, Political Science and International Relations, Strategy and Management, Urban Studies and Management of Technology and Innovation, having authored 82 papers that have together received 839 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Regional Economics and Spatial Analysis (19 papers), Economic Growth and Productivity (14 papers), Economic theories and models (12 papers), Regional Development and Policy (10 papers), Fiscal Policy and Economic Growth (8 papers), Business Strategy and Innovation (6 papers), Cultural Industries and Urban Development (6 papers) and University-Industry-Government Innovation Models (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Economics and Econometrics (523 citations), Urban Studies (107 citations), General Economics, Econometrics and Finance (89 citations), Transportation (55 citations) and Strategy and Management (118 citations). Åke E. Andersson has collaborated with scholars based in Sweden, Taiwan and United States. Frequent co-authors include David Emanuel Andersson, David F. Batten, Börje Johansson, Björn Hårsman, Charlie Karlsson, Olle Persson, Peter Nijkamp, Nils‐Eric Sahlin, Martin J. Beckmann and Kiyoshi Kobayashi. Their work appears in journals such as Papers of the Regional Science Association, Regional Science and Urban Economics, The Annals of Regional Science, Journal of Computational and Applied Mathematics and Technological Forecasting and Social Change.
